#2cca0d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2cca0d is composed of 17.3% red, 79.2%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 93.6%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 110.2 degrees, a saturation of 87.9% and a lightness of 42.2%. #2cca0d color hex could be obtained by blending #58ff1a with #009500.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

#2cca0d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2cca0d has RGB values of R:44, G:202, B:13 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0, Y:0.94,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 2935309.

Shades and Tints of #2cca0d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#041201 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.
